> I begin to suspect that you have some problems with character encoding or
> line endings in the text file. Do you, by chance, use old-style Mac 
> line-endings
> (i.e. just a CR)? In that case, try to save the file using the new Mac OS X
> convention (which is the same as UNIX has always been using) to use LF for
> line endings.
